随着技术的不断发展,区块链已成为当今最炙手可热的话题之一。它的核心创新技术不仅在金融领域引起了巨大的关注,也在供应链、物联网、医疗健康、知识产权等多个行业展现出独特的潜力和应用前景。区块链的去中心化、不可篡改、安全透明等特点,使其成为定制各种数字应用的理想选择。

在这篇文章中,我们将深入探讨区块链的核心创新技术,包括其基础概念、关键组成部分及其在各个领域的实际应用。同时,我们还将回答一些与区块链相关的常见问题,以帮助读者更全面地理解这一前沿领域。

一、区块链是什么?

区块链是一种分布式账本技术,允许在不同参与者之间安全、透明地记录交易。其基本特点包括去中心化、不可篡改、数据透明和高安全性。区块链通过将数据分散存储在网络中的多个节点上,消除了传统中心化系统对单个实体的依赖,增强了系统的抗攻击能力。

每一个“区块”都包含一组交易数据,并通过加密技术链接到前一个区块,从而形成一个“链”。这种结构使得一旦数据被记录,就几乎不可能被更改,除了该区块链上大多数节点的同意。这种特性使得区块链在解决信任问题方面展现出巨大的优势,非常适合需要透明、可信交易的场景。

二、区块链的核心组成部分

区块链的核心组成部分主要包括以下几个方面:

  • 分布式网络:区块链由多个节点(参与者)组成,所有节点共同维护账本,确保数据同步。
  • 加密算法:区块链使用哈希函数和公私钥加密技术,保证数据的安全性和隐私性。
  • 智能合约:一种运行在区块链上的自动化合约,允许在满足特定条件时自动执行交易或协议。
  • 共识机制:一种确保网络中所有节点遵循相同规则并达成一致的协议,常见的有工作量证明(PoW)、权益证明(PoS)等。

三、区块链技术的特点与优势

区块链技术具备多个显著的特点与优势,这些特性使其在许多领域拥有广泛的应用前景:

  • 去中心化:区块链不依赖单一的中心机构,有效降低了成本和风险。
  • 安全性:其数据经过加密和验证,抵御数据篡改和网络攻击。
  • 透明性:交易记录公开可查,任何人都可以验证,增强了信任。
  • 高效性:通过智能合约,区块链可以实现自动化交易,提高业务处理效率。

四、区块链技术的实际应用

区块链的应用场景十分广泛,包括但不限于:

  • 金融服务:如数字货币、跨境支付、资产交易等。
  • 供应链管理:可追溯性,确保产品的来源和质量。
  • 医疗健康:患者数据安全与共享,提高医疗效率与准确性。
  • 知识产权保护:为创作作品提供更好的认证和管理方式。

可能相关问题

1. 区块链如何确保数据的安全性?

区块链通过多种机制确保数据的安全性。首先是数据加密,所有的交易记录通过专业的加密算法进行加密处理,确保只有合法权限的用户才能访问数据。其次,数据通过分散方式存储在网络中的多个节点上,一旦记录,就几乎无法被篡改,因为要更改一个区块的信息,需要同时掌握网络中绝大多数节点的控制权,这在实际操作中几乎是不可能的。此外,区块链还使用共识机制,确保所有的节点对交易记录达成一致,从而增强了数据的可信性。

如果有人试图更改某个区块的数据,伴随这个区块的所有后续区块都会受到影响,形成链条效应,从而导致其余节点对其合法性的质疑。这种设计大幅度提升了数据的安全性和可靠性。

2. 区块链技术的实现过程是怎样的?

区块链的实现过程主要包括以下几个步骤:

  1. 交易创建:用户发起交易请求,相关数据通过加密后形成未确认的交易。
  2. 交易验证:网络节点对新增交易进行验证,确保其合法性。
  3. 区块生成:经过验证的交易会被打包入新区块,等待加入区块链。
  4. 共识达成:所有节点通过共识机制达成一致,决定新的区块是否加入链上。
  5. 区块追加:经共识的区块被加入到末尾,成为区块链的一部分,所有节点更新各自的账本。

这一过程相对迅速,能够支持高频次的交易需求,因此在金融科技等领域得到广泛应用。

3. 区块链技术的未来发展趋势是怎样的?

未来,区块链技术将继续发展,并在多个领域产生重要影响。以下是几个主要的发展趋势:

  • 互操作性:不同区块链之间的互操作性将变得越来越普遍,能够提高数据共享和业务交互的效率。
  • 隐私保护:未来的区块链将更加注重用户隐私,通过零知识证明等技术来保证隐私,同时不影响链上数据的透明性。
  • 企业级应用:越来越多的大型企业将推动区块链技术走向业务应用场景,形成企业级的应用解决方案。
  • 政策与法规:各国政府及相关机构可能会出台更多的监管政策,以促进区块链的健康发展。

总之,随着技术的不断完善与应用场景的逐步探索,区块链将在未来的数字经济中占据更加重要的地位。

4. 智能合约在区块链中的作用是什么?

智能合约是区块链的一项核心创新技术,它自我执行、无需中介,能够根据事先设定的规则保证交易的自动化执行。智能合约会存储在区块链中,当合约条件满足时,会自动执行,确保各方利益。

这种机制使得智能合约在金融交易、供应链管理、权益转让等领域的应用成为可能。比如在房地产交易中,智能合约可以自动验证支付,并在租约到期时自动返还押金,避免了人为干预可能带来的误差与风险。

智能合约的出现不仅提升了交易的效率,还有效降低了交易成本,因此被广泛应用于各类商业场景中。

5. 区块链技术面临的挑战是什么?

尽管区块链技术展现了巨大的潜力,但依然面临众多挑战。首先是技术障碍,虽然技术在不断进步,但依然存在可扩展性、交易速度低等问题,限制了其在高频交易等场景的应用。其次是能源消耗,特别是在使用工作量证明共识机制的区块链网络中,资源消耗极为惊人,这引发了人们对可持续性的担忧。

接着是法规与政策的滞后,关于区块链的法律法规尚未完全明确,这为企业及个人在使用区块链技术时带来了合规风险。同时,网络安全问题也不容忽视,黑客攻击、一旦成功实施将对用户和平台造成巨大的损失。

最后是公众认知度,尽管区块链被广泛传播,但很多普通用户仍对其功能和应用缺乏深入了解,这在一定程度上也制约了区块链技术的普及。

6. 如何选择合适的区块链平台?

选择合适的区块链平台时,用户需要综合考虑以下多个因素:

  • 功能需求:首先要基于实际业务需求,了解各平台提供的功能是否满足业务场景。
  • 技术架构:关注平台的共识机制、智能合约功能和可扩展性等技术架构上的优势。
  • 社区支持:强大的社区支持将有助于平台的生态发展,选择社区活跃的平台可能会获得更好的技术支持和更新。
  • 安全性:评估平台的安全机制,如加密技术、网络容错能力等。
  • 成本因素:不同平台的交易费用、运营维护成本差异很大,需根据预算进行选择。

总之,选择合适的区块链平台应根据具体业务需求及未来发展方向综合考虑,以获得最佳的投资回报率。

区块链作为现代科技的重要代表,正不断重塑着我们生活的方方面面。通过对其核心创新技术的探讨与应用前景的展望,希望能够帮助您进一步理解并掌握这一行业的动态与趋势。